Exploring the Best Historical Romance Authors
Historical romance has a timeless allure, transporting readers to different eras filled with passion, intrigue, and unforgettable love stories. Within this genre, there are several standout authors who have captivated readers with their evocative storytelling and rich historical settings.
Jane Austen
Jane Austen is a literary icon known for her classic novels such as “Pride and Prejudice” and “Sense and Sensibility.” Her works are revered for their wit, social commentary, and timeless romance set against the backdrop of Regency-era England.
Georgette Heyer
Georgette Heyer is often hailed as the queen of Regency romance. Her meticulously researched novels capture the elegance and charm of the Regency period, featuring engaging characters, sparkling dialogue, and delightful romantic escapades.
Lisa Kleypas
Lisa Kleypas is a bestselling author renowned for her compelling historical romances. Her books seamlessly blend passion, emotion, and historical detail, creating immersive love stories that resonate with readers long after they’ve turned the final page.
Julia Quinn
Julia Quinn is beloved for her witty and enchanting historical romances that brim with humour, heart, and irresistible chemistry between her characters. Her Bridgerton series has garnered widespread acclaim for its captivating storytelling and vibrant characters.
Eloisa James
Eloisa James weaves enchanting tales of love and intrigue set in various historical periods. Known for her lush prose and complex characters, she creates vivid worlds that draw readers into a whirlwind of passion, drama, and romance.

What are some popular historical romance novels?
When it comes to popular historical romance novels, there is no shortage of captivating reads that transport readers to different eras and whisk them away on romantic adventures. Titles such as “Pride and Prejudice” by Jane Austen, “Outlander” by Diana Gabaldon, “The Duke and I” by Julia Quinn, “The Bronze Horseman” by Paullina Simons, and “A Knight in Shining Armor” by Jude Deveraux are just a few examples of beloved historical romance novels that have captured the hearts of readers worldwide. These books offer a blend of compelling storytelling, rich historical detail, and unforgettable love stories that continue to resonate with audiences across generations.
Which historical period do most historical romance authors write about?
Historical romance authors often gravitate towards writing about the Regency era, which spans from the late 18th century to the early 19th century in England. This period, known for its elegance, societal norms, and intricate courtship rituals, provides a rich tapestry for romantic storytelling. Authors are drawn to the Regency era’s opulent ballrooms, scandalous intrigues, and societal expectations that create a captivating backdrop for love to blossom amidst challenges and triumphs. While the Regency era is a popular choice among historical romance authors, some also explore other periods such as medieval times, Victorian era, or even ancient civilizations, each offering unique settings and dynamics for romantic narratives to unfold.
Are there any modern authors who excel in writing historical romance?
In the realm of historical romance literature, there are indeed modern authors who excel in capturing the essence of bygone eras with their compelling storytelling and vibrant characters. Contemporary writers such as Sarah MacLean, Tessa Dare, and Evie Dunmore have made a significant impact on the genre with their fresh perspectives, dynamic narratives, and emotionally resonant romances. These talented authors skillfully blend historical accuracy with modern sensibilities, creating immersive worlds that transport readers to different time periods while delivering timeless tales of love, passion, and intrigue.
